The Indian Institute of Banking and Finance or IIBF is a professional body that comprises all the banks, financial institutions, and employees working in them. Their main aim is in imparting professional knowledge with their flagship courses being Certified Associate of Indian Institute of Bankers (CAIIB) and the Junior Associate of Indian Institute of Bankers (JAIIB).

About IIBF

The IIBF is one of the most unique institutes of its kind as it encompasses over 3,00,000 employees as individual members and about 700 banks and financial institutions as institutional members. The IIBF carries out its activities with the main mission

to develop professionally qualified and competent bankers and finance professionals primarily through a process of training, education, consultancy/counseling, examination, and continuing professional development programs”.

IIBF also helps its members in attaining various certifications along with JAIIB and CAIIB such as Diploma courses in diverse categories such as

  1. Diploma in Banking and Technology
  2. Diploma in Advanced Wealth Management
  3. Diploma in Comm Derivatives for Bankers
  4. Diploma Examination for Micro Finance Professionals
  5. Advance Diploma in Urban Co-operative Banking and other certification programs.

IIBF also provides Distance Learning courses such as

  1. Publishing workbooks
  2. E-learning through portal
  3. Publishing specific courseware for each paper/examination
  4. Virtual classes
  5. Contact classes
  6. Campus training for chosen courses, etc.

These courses provided by the IIBF are considered to be some of the best in the field and have also been known to be detailed and taught exhaustively.

IIBF Exam

After completing the registration process, one can move forward to the JAIIB exam or junior Associate of the Indian Institute of Bankers exam which is conducted by the Indian Institute of Bankers (IIBF). This exam is only open to the ordinary members of the Institute.

In the year 2020, the examination will be conducted on Sunday in the month of May/June and October/November as the exam is conducted twice in a year. The list of all the examination centers at which it will be conducted will be provided on the JAIIB online application form.

The eligibility criteria for this exam are as follows:

  1. The examination JAIIB is only open for the ordinary members of the Institute.
  2. The examinee must have passed his/her 12th standard in any discipline or its equivalent. Only the Institute, on its own discretion, can allow some candidate from supervisory or clerical staff cadre of the banks to give the examination on the personal recommendation of the manager of the bank or of the officer in charge of the bank’s office at which the candidate is working and in such case, the candidate need not be compulsorily qualified in 12th standard or any of its equivalent. 
  3. The subordinate staff of the recognized banking which are the members of the institute are also eligible to appear for the examination.

IIBF Certificate Exam

IIBF Certificate Exam is particularly designed in collaboration with the Institute for financial management and research, Chennai to familiarize candidates with the basic level issues arising in the financing projects, as well as risk analysis and risk mitigation methodologies with a specific emphasis on structured financing.

In recent years, project financing has become one of the core activities of banking. With the continuous growth in the economy and the revival in the industrial sector intertwined with the increasing role of private constituents in the field of infrastructure, more and more banks are entering into the project finance area.

All the candidates will also be taken through the whole process of building financial models for projects which are handled by them. The program is mixed with e-learning, non-residential campus training, project work, online training, and certification at the end of the course.

The coverage of this program is:

  1. Basic characteristics of project finance 
  2. Technology selection, assessment of the technical collaborator
  3. Assessing the project cost
  4. Means of financing projects
  5. Market analysis: International competitiveness and SWOT analysis
  6. Estimation of project cash flows
  7. Use of free and equity cash flow valuation for assessing projects
  8. Common risks in projects

IIBF BC Exam

IIBF BC or business correspondents(BCs) play an important role in achieving financial inclusion. The BCS basically acts as a bridge between the bank branches and the people of that particular area. A BC is basically the first point of contact and the front face of any bank branch to the people.

In order to make the BCs more effective, they need to be imparted to the desired level of knowledge. In this context, the Indian institute of banking and finance or IBF has launched a certificate examination which has these following objectives:

  1. The role/ functions of any bank
  2. The basics of banking operations and procedures 
  3. Roles and functions of all the BCs and BFs 
  4. Financial advising and counseling
  5. PMJDY, PMJJBY, PMSBY, and APY
  6. Schemes which are sponsored by central and local governments.

IIBF KYC Exam

The IIBF has also entered into a partnership with IFIM Business School in Bangalore which is improving their vast repertoire of courses provided. The courses provided will be in digital banking, AML-KYC, banking and finance, ethics in banking, etc.

The objective of the KYC exam are:

  1. Provide comprehensive coverage of the various guidelines issued by RBI, international bodies, etc.
  2. To provide advanced knowledge of AML/KYC standards
  3. To develop the professional competence of employees of banks and financial institutions.

IIBF Mock Test

Hitherto, the IIBF Mock Test facility was being made available only to those candidates who had completed the registration process for the concerned examination. Now, a decision has been taken by the Institute to make the mock test facility, for some subjects, available to any serving bank employee on payment of the requisite amount. You can also buy books that will help you with the exam.

The facility of the mock test provided by IIBF is available for these certain subjects-

  1. JAIIB(All the 3 papers)
  2. CAIIB(2 compulsory papers)
  3. Certified credit professional
  4. Certified treasury professional
  5. Risk in financial services

IIBF Courses

The governing council of the IIBF consists of representatives from various institutions such as the Reserve Bank of India, important finance-related bodies, Public sector banks, Private and Foreign banks, etc. Eminent practitioners in the field head the Education and Research Committee of IIBF and ensure that the functioning has been carried out adhering to the utmost standard.

A Chartered Banker status can be attained through the IIBF Professional Conversion Programme for all those who have successfully completed The Certified Associates of the Indian Institute of Bankers (CAIIB) qualification.

The three types of courses offered by IIBF is-

  1. Flagship courses
  2. Diploma courses
  3. Blended courses

IIBF CAIIB

CAIIB stands for a certified association of the Indian Institute of banking and it is an examination conducted by IIBF twice a year.

Compulsory papers of this exam are:

  1. Advanced bank management
  2. Bank financial management

While the optional parts are:

  1. Corporate banking
  2. Central banking
  3. Rural banking
  4. Co-operative banking
  5. Retail banking
  6. International banking
  7. Financial advising
  8. Treasury management
  9. Risk management
  10. Human resources management
  11. Information technology
